ArcGIS实验操作(八)---地形特征提取
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
ArcGIS实验操作(八
地形特征信息提取
数据:在data/Ex8/文件下
·dem:分辨率为5米的栅格DEM数据。
·Result文件夹:
·shanji:提取的山脊线栅格数据;
·shangu:提取的山谷线栅格数据;
·hillshade:地形晕渲图。
要求:
利用所给区域DEM数据,提取该区域山脊线、山谷线栅格数据层。
操作步骤:
1.加载DEM数据,设置默认存储路径,使用空间分析模块下拉箭头中的表面分析工具,
选择坡向工具(Aspect,提取DEM的坡向数据层,命名为A。
该DEM的坡向数据如下图所示:
提取A的坡度数据层,命名为SOA1。
3.求取原始DEM数据层的最大高程值,记为H:
由此可见该最大高程值H为1153.79 使用栅格计算器,公式为(H-DEM,求反地形DEM数据如下:
反地形DEM数据层calculation如下(可与原始DEM相比较:
4.基于反地形DEM数据求算坡向值
反地形DEM数据层calculation的坡向数据如下:
5.提取反地形DEM坡向数据的坡度数据,记为SOA2,即利用SOA方法求算反地形的坡
向变率。
6.使用空间分析工具集中的栅格计算器,求没有误差的DEM的坡向变率SOA,公式为
SOA=(([SOA1]+[SOA2]-Abs([SOA1] -[SOA2]/2
其中,Abs为求算绝对值,可点击右下侧将其查找出来。
没有误差的DEM的坡向变率SOA如下图所示:
7.再次点击初始DEM数据,使用空间分析工具集中的栅格邻域计算工具(Nerghborhood
Statistics;设置统计类型为平均值(mean邻域的类型为矩形(也可以为圆,邻域的大小为11×11(这个值也可以根据自己的需要进行改变,则可得到一个邻域为11×11
的矩形的平均值数据层,记为B。
8.使用空间分析工具集中的栅格计算器,求算正负地形分布区域,公式为C = [DEM]-[B]。
9.使用空间分析工具集中的栅格计算器,即可求出山脊线,公式为shanji =
[C]>0&SOA>70。
说明:和(&,它是比较两个或两个以上栅格数据层,如果对应的栅格值均为非0值,则输
出结果为真,(赋值1,否则输出结果为假(赋值0。
选中 shanji 数据层,将属性值为 0 的设为空值,透明显示:
使用表面分析中的 hillshape 工具,创建地形晕渲图 hillshade,叠加在 shanji 数据层之下,地图显示效果更佳。 10. 同上,在栅格计算器中,键入公式 shangu=[C]<0&SOA>70,可求得山谷线:
将计算结果进行重分类,所有属性不为 1 的栅格属性赋值为 NoData:
将山谷线数据层 re_shangu 与地形晕渲图 hillshade 叠加,地图窗口显示如下: